Breaking News: Lieutenant Ebru Eroğlu's reinstatement lawsuit rejected

The Ankara 4th Administrative Court has rejected the reinstatement lawsuit filed by Lieutenant Ebru Eroğlu, who was dismissed from the Turkish Armed Forces (TAF) for leading the recitation of the officer's oath following the Military Academy graduation ceremony.

The lawsuit filed by Ebru Eroğlu, one of the lieutenants dismissed from the Turkish Armed Forces for chanting the slogan "We are the soldiers of Mustafa Kemal" while crossing swords at the Military Academy graduation ceremony held on August 30, 2024, has been concluded.

The Ankara 4th Administrative Court rejected the request for the cancellation of the separation decision issued by the Land Forces Command High Disciplinary Board.

The court's reasoned decision has been served to the parties. The decision stated that, considering the scope of the act in question and its effects, it was evaluated as being detrimental to the reputation of the Turkish Armed Forces.

Furthermore, the decision stated that the act created a perception in society that the military oath had been abandoned, and that this situation could negatively affect the trust placed in the institution. It was also emphasized that a conviction had been formed that the organization regarding the recitation of the oath, which had been removed from the legislation, was planned in advance.

Within the framework of these evaluations, the court ruled that there was no illegality in the High Disciplinary Board's decision and rejected the case.
